Present Job Market and Employment Alternatives

The job marketplace for courtroom reporters is experiencing a surge because of the elevated demand for expert professionals who can effectively and precisely seize testimony and different courtroom proceedings. Based on the Bureau of Labor Statistics, employment of courtroom reporters is projected to develop 10% from 2020 to 2030, sooner than the typical for all occupations. This progress is pushed by the growing want for dependable and correct transcripts in numerous sectors, together with legislation, medication, and authorities.

  1. Employment alternatives within the courtroom reporting career are anticipated to rise, pushed by developments in expertise and the elevated want for correct and dependable transcripts.
  2. Employment charges will differ relying on geographical location, with metropolitan areas having a better demand for courtroom reporters than rural areas.

Wage Ranges and Advantages

Salaries for courtroom reporters differ relying on elements like location, expertise, and sort of employer. Based on the Nationwide Court docket Reporters Affiliation, the median annual wage for courtroom reporters in america is round $68,600. Freelance courtroom reporters can earn larger wages, usually $100-$150 per hour, however should additionally think about bills like gear, software program, and enterprise overhead.

Wage Vary (Annual) Employment Sector
$60,000-$80,000 Authorities Companies and Courts
$80,000-$100,000 Non-public Firms and Regulation Corporations
